Luharwara is a village situated in Badwara tehsil of Katni district in Madhya Pradesh.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 110 families residing in the village Luharwara. The total population of Luharwara is 504 out of which 264 are males and 240 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Luharwara is 909.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Luharwara village is 72 which is 14% of the total population. There are 44 male children and 28 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Luharwara is 636 which is less than Average Sex Ratio (909) of Luharwara village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Luharwara is 71.1%. Thus Luharwara village has a higher literacy rate compared to 61.2% of Katni district. The male literacy rate is 85% and the female literacy rate is 56.6% in Luharwara village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 7.7%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 56.5% of total population in Luharwara village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Luharwara village out of total population, 279 were engaged in work activities. 50.2%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 49.8%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 279 workers engaged in Main Work, 87 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 39 were Agricultural labourers.
